當(dāng)前位置:工程項(xiàng)目OA系統(tǒng) > 泛普各地 > 江西OA系統(tǒng) > 南昌OA系統(tǒng) > 南昌網(wǎng)站建設(shè)公司
PHP讀取創(chuàng)建txt,doc,xls,pdf類(lèi)型文件
申請(qǐng)免費(fèi)試用、咨詢(xún)電話(huà):400-8352-114
PHP讀取或許創(chuàng)立txt,doc,xls,pdf各個(gè)類(lèi)型文件的辦法. 南昌網(wǎng)站建設(shè)php讀取(文本.txt)文件:
	普通是運(yùn)用fopen、fgets的辦法,例如:
	<?php
	$fp=fopen('文件名.txt','r');
	for ($i=1;$i<100;$i++) fgets($fp);//跳過(guò)前99行
	$arr=array();//初始化數(shù)組
	for ($i=0;$i<100;$i++) $arr[]=fgets($fp);//讀出100~200行
	fclose($fp);
	//下面輸出內(nèi)容
	echo '
';
for ($i=0;$i<50;$i++){
echo ' '.$arr[$i].' '.$arr[$i+50];
}
echo '
	';
	?>
	
	以上是若何用php讀取txt文件的第n到第n+100行,并輸出。
	讀取第100到第200行,然后用50行2列的表格輸出。
php讀?。╳ord .doc)文件:
	
	header(Content-type:application/msword);
$fp=fopen("xxx.doc",r);
	
	$file=file($fp);
	foreach($file as $k=>;$v){
	
	echo $v;
	}
	<?php
$word = new COM("word.application") or die("無(wú)法定位WORD裝置途徑!");
	
	print "加載WORD( 版本: )成功,曾經(jīng)保管在您的硬盤(pán)上了。n";
	
	//將其置前
$word->Visible = 1;
	
	//翻開(kāi)一個(gè)空文檔
	$word->Documents->Add();
	//隨意做些工作
	$word->Selection->TypeText("這是一個(gè)在PHP中挪用COM的測(cè)試。");
	//$word->Selection->TypeText("This is a test.。");
	$word->Documents[1]->SaveAs("test.doc");
	
	//封閉 word
	$word->Quit();
//釋放對(duì)象
	
	$word->Release();
	$word = null;
?>
php讀?。‥xcel.xls)文件(csv文件):
	
	起首把xls轉(zhuǎn)化為csv花樣的,然后運(yùn)用下面辦法讀取csv花樣文件就可以了。
	header("Content-type:html/txt");
	$row = 1;
	$handle = fopen("jxw-501-600.csv","r");
	while ($data = fgetcsv($handle, 1000, ",")) {
	    $num = count($data);
	    echo "
	$num fields in line $row:
	\n";
	    $row++;
	    for ($c=0; $c < $num; $c++) {
	        echo $data[$c] . "
	\n";
	    }
	}
	fclose($handle);
	運(yùn)用表單上傳word文件到數(shù)據(jù)庫(kù) 然后翻開(kāi)數(shù)據(jù)庫(kù)的word。
	
	第二種 是把word 轉(zhuǎn)換為PDF 用world轉(zhuǎn)換東西 ,然后在吧PDF 導(dǎo)入到頁(yè)面上
	php讀取pdf文件
	<?PHP
	// 創(chuàng)立一個(gè)新的pdf文檔句柄
	$pdf = pdf_new();
	// 翻開(kāi)一個(gè)文件
	pdf_open_file($pdf, "pdftest.pdf");
	// 開(kāi)端一個(gè)新頁(yè)面(a4)
	pdf_begin_page($pdf, 595, 842);
	// 獲得并運(yùn)用字體對(duì)象
$arial = pdf_findfont($pdf, "arial", "host", 1);
pdf_setfont($pdf, $arial, 10);
// 輸出文字
	pdf_show_xy($pdf, "this is an exam of pdf documents, it is a good lib,",50, 750);
	pdf_show_xy($pdf, "if you like,please try yourself!", 50, 730);
// 完畢一頁(yè)
pdf_end_page($pdf);
// 封閉并保管文件
	
	pdf_close($pdf);
- 1網(wǎng)站優(yōu)化操作誤區(qū)
 - 2納客會(huì)員管理軟件怎么購(gòu)買(mǎi)付款,納客付款流程
 - 3移動(dòng)pos機(jī)的便捷之處
 - 4沙盤(pán)模型是如今樓盤(pán)銷(xiāo)售必備有銷(xiāo)售工具
 - 5網(wǎng)絡(luò)公司宣傳應(yīng)該特別注意的事項(xiàng)
 - 6網(wǎng)站優(yōu)化的靈活性
 - 7ERP管理軟件華睿公司能為您解決的
 - 8優(yōu)化的策略與步驟
 - 9連鎖軟件系統(tǒng)數(shù)據(jù)是ERP系統(tǒng)的靈魂
 - 10網(wǎng)站優(yōu)化需多長(zhǎng)時(shí)間
 - 11新點(diǎn)子商務(wù)特大網(wǎng)站定位
 - 12影響企業(yè)網(wǎng)站排名的幾個(gè)因素
 - 13影響網(wǎng)站排名的因素—互動(dòng)
 - 14關(guān)于虛擬機(jī)管理的五個(gè)關(guān)鍵性問(wèn)題
 - 15服務(wù)器經(jīng)常出現(xiàn)打不開(kāi),對(duì)網(wǎng)站排名的影響大
 - 16互聯(lián)網(wǎng)域名本地化與個(gè)性化
 - 17在熱水器進(jìn)水口前安裝減壓益或者使出水口敞開(kāi)
 - 18瓷磚出現(xiàn)裂紋的方位主要有下層裂紋、表面龜裂
 - 19寫(xiě)原創(chuàng)文章的技巧
 - 20云庫(kù)文化
 - 21一個(gè)好網(wǎng)站最起碼應(yīng)該具備哪些特點(diǎn)?
 - 22網(wǎng)站建設(shè)中域名可以使用哪些字符
 - 23內(nèi)容除了原創(chuàng)與相關(guān)性,我們還要注意什么?
 - 24如何通過(guò)優(yōu)化網(wǎng)站何提升網(wǎng)站的轉(zhuǎn)化率
 - 25互聯(lián)網(wǎng)營(yíng)銷(xiāo)應(yīng)從好域名開(kāi)始
 - 26建議大家至少應(yīng)該選擇中等以上的產(chǎn)品
 - 27網(wǎng)站運(yùn)營(yíng)的搜索引擎優(yōu)化策略
 - 28華睿管理軟件“五大優(yōu)勢(shì)”讓你降低成本
 - 29大羽羽絨服使用納客會(huì)員管理系統(tǒng)
 - 30寶雞網(wǎng)站建設(shè)教你如何良好的進(jìn)行企業(yè)網(wǎng)站建設(shè)
 
成都公司:成都市成華區(qū)建設(shè)南路160號(hào)1層9號(hào)
重慶公司:重慶市江北區(qū)紅旗河溝華創(chuàng)商務(wù)大廈18樓


